A man is being treated in hospital after he was assaulted in Dublin City Centre last night.
The victim, a man in his 30s, was taken to the Mater Hospital following the incident that took place on Dorset Street Lower at around 9pm.
His injuries are described as not life-threatening.
Gardai and emergency services attended the scene, which was later preserved for technical examination.
Meanwhile a Garda spokesperson told Sunday World investigations into the assault are ongoing.

“Gardaí and emergency services were alerted to an assault that occurred on Dorset Street Lower in Dublin 1 at approximately 9pm last night,” the spokesperson said.
“A man aged in his 30s was brought to the Mater Misericordiae University Hospital for treatment of injuries, not believed to be life-threatening.
“The scene was preserved and a technical examination conducted. Investigations are ongoing.”
